The 113th edition of the Tour de France is scheduled to commence in Barcelona on July 4, 2026, with its conclusion in Paris on July 26, 2026. This year's race features a star-studded lineup, including defending champion Tadej Pogacar, Mathieu van der Poel, and Remco Evenepoel.
Pogacar, who secured his fourth consecutive victory last year, is determined to retain his crown. He is making his return to racing in Switzerland, where he has indicated he is keeping his strategies undisclosed. The event promises an intense competition across France and Spain, with numerous top cycling teams vying for supremacy.
A full list of participating teams includes UAE Team Emirates-XRG, Alpecin-Premier Tech, Red Bull-Bora-Hansgrohe, and Visma-Lease a Bike, among others. Fans can anticipate thrilling action as these elite athletes compete for cycling's most prestigious title.
